Analysis
In 2020, ipcc agriculture — emissions (co2) — unfccc in Belarus stood at 858.92 kt.
Compared with earlier readings it is down 1.1% on the previous year and down 34.9% over ten years.
Over the whole period, ipcc agriculture — emissions (co2) — unfccc in Belarus peaked at 1,963 kt in 1992 and was at its lowest, 800.19 kt, in 2000.
That places Belarus 10th out of 40 countries with data for 2020, putting it in the top quarter.
The long-run direction has been consistently falling across the 29 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
